Handover — lost-badge procedure (for whoever covers the desk next)

New starters lose badges constantly, so here's the drill. Check the lost-property drawer first; half turn up there. If not found within an hour, deactivate the old badge in the Gatewise panel and log it under the starter's name. Issue a day pass, max 48 hours, and book them a reprint slot with the badge printer upstairs. The day-pass stock lives in the locked cabinet, opened with the code below.

turnstile pass: bdg-QZV-3

// REINDEX_BATCH_CAP limits docs per shard pass in the Tallowfield
// nightly search reindex. Raising it starves the ingest queue;
// lowering it overruns the maintenance window. 5000 is the tested
// sweet spot. Change only with a soak run. Verified against the
// build noted below.

session token of bawif-hahog = htk6_ac5981

## Support

The Ferngate address autocomplete widget is maintained by the Mapletide frontend platform group. For security findings, do not open a public issue; disclosures are triaged privately with a 48-hour acknowledgement target. Include the widget version, embedding context, and reproduction steps. Dependency and CSP questions are covered in the hardening guide in this repo. For anything sensitive, including suspected injection or data-leak vectors, contact the maintainers directly.

escalation mailbox, yajeg-bageg: quenax.olidor@lumiccorp.internal

## User Module Extraction

As part of splitting the Hollowpine monolith, the user module is moving into a standalone service called Ferngate. Plugin authors should stop reading user records directly from the shared database; those tables will be dropped after the migration window. Instead, consume the new identity events and the read-only profile API, both versioned independently of the monolith. Migration timelines, event schemas, and deprecation dates are published on the internal page below.

dashboard of yahaf-kajep = https://jira.zemvarsys.internal/display/projects/browse/browse/a08b